    Infinti Retail Limited (d/b/a Cromā) is an Indian retail chain of consumer electronics and durable goods, it is a subsidiary of the Tata Digital. [ 3 ] [ 4 ] Croma offers over 16,000 products across 550+ brands through its stores spread in numerous major cities of India.

    Walmart Inc. (/ ˈ w ɔː l m ɑːr t / ⓘ; formerly Wal-Mart Stores, Inc.) is an American multinational retail corporation that operates a chain of hypermarkets (also called supercenters), discount department stores, and grocery stores in the United States and 23 other countries.

    Spencer Gifts LLC, doing business as Spencer's, is a North American mall retailer with over 600 stores in the United States and Canada.Its stores specialize in novelty and gag gifts, and also sell clothing, brand merchandise, sex toys, room decor, collectible figures, fashion and body jewelry, and fantasy and horror items.
